The Nigerian Police Force has been asked to release a journalist and other protesters arrested at the Lekki Tollgate on Wednesday, according to the Socio-Economic Rights and Accountability Project.
SERAP issued a statement on its official Twitter account, urging authorities to release those who have been detained while also stating that they have the right to protest.
"Nigerian authorities must release two protesters, including a journalist, who were reportedly arrested this morning by the Lagos State Police Command at the Lekki tollgate, where the #EndSARSMemorial protest is scheduled to take place," the statement reads. Protesting is a legal right."
The protesters marched to the Lekki toll gate in a car procession to commemorate the alleged killings of Nigerians on the same day last year. Nigerian police officers, on the other hand, have been arresting peaceful protesters.
